Description: A plastic bottle has a hole at the bottom. A laser shines on the stream of water to demonstrate total internal reflection. |

| Copyright © 2000 | Instructions: Fill the 3 liter bottle with water and close lid tightly so that the water no longer drips out (unless squeezed). Turn off lights. Loosen cap and shine laser on hole from the opposite side of the bottle. |
